The final tidbit on adrenaline is that, as the resting metabolic rate falls, you become less responsive to adrenaline. Some people feel like their adrenal glands are burned out and no longer are producing adrenal hormones. In some cases, you do see true hypoadrenia or “adrenal fatigue.” But in some cases your adrenal hormones are carrying on as normal, but you are unresponsive. Although you probably won’t hear much about this effect anywhere else, I did come across this fascinating insight while reading The Biology of Human Starvation by Ancel Keys. In the starved state they injected men with adrenaline and it had virtually no effect on them like it would a normal person. They saw very little elevation in pulse, energy, etc. So for some, low resting metabolic rate may be at the core of someone’s apparent shortage of adrenaline and appearance of asthma and other inflammatory disorders.

On to carbon dioxide…

Two researchers that have a strong following amongst 180DegreeHealth fans are Ray Peat and Buteyko – that breathing guy. Ray Peat is very pro-carbon dioxide as you can read about in these fascinating but notoriously hard-to-grasp articles…

http://raypeat.com/articles/articles/lactate.shtml
http://raypeat.com/articles/articles/co2.shtml

Buteyko is a researcher that felt that modern man, with his jacked up nostrils and facial formation, was having greater and greater difficulty breathing correctly – which is gently through the nose and not sucking air through an open mouth like you see a large percentage of the customers at Wal Mart doing. The problem, as he saw it, was hyperventilation – or breathing too much. The more you exhale, the more carbon dioxide escapes from the body, which is why, when an asthmatic has a sudden burst of exercise and begins breathing rapidly, he or she can often trigger a strong asthma attack. I know personally that nothing triggers a good asthma attack like running hard without a warmup, in cold weather.

The constriction in the lungs is to prevent carbon dioxide loss. Sure, an asthma attack feels like an oxygen shortage, but that is really just a byproduct of the body trying to minimize the escape of carbon dioxide. By teaching people to breathe less frequently, stop their hyperventilating, and in turn raise CO2 levels – which supposedly has far-reaching physiological benefits, Buteyko has been very successful in helping people overcome various health problems. Asthmatics, if you believe the hype, seem to respond very well to this type of therapy.

Interestingly, when you eat fat as your primary fuel source, your carbon dioxide levels tend to fall – as burning fat for fuel does not yield carbon dioxide as a byproduct the way that cleaving a molecule like sucrose does. Eat a higher sugar diet and your carbon dioxide levels are bound to increase.
